Death Claims Mrs. Cara Bell Hughes
Funeral Service
is Conducted At First Baptist Church
Mrs. Cara Belle
Hughes, wife of R. N. Hughes, died in a local hospital at 1 o’clock Wednesday
morning. She had been ill with pneumonia for only a few days.
The funeral
was scheduled for 3 o’clock Wednesday afternoon at the First Baptist church,
Rev. W. B. Wadsworth, pastor of the church, officiating. Burial was
to be at Forest Hill Cemetery. Funeral arrangements were in charge
of the Pace-Stancil Funeral Home.
Mrs. Hughes, who was
66 years of age, was born in South Carolina, December 31, 1869. She
came to Texas many years ago, living for a number of years in Montgomery
County. She and Mr. Hughes came to Livingston when it was quite small
and their home seemed very far out in the country. Mr. Hughes has
been in poor health for some time.
Besides her husband,
Mrs. Hughes is survived by two sons, Eddie and Pat Hughes, both of Livingston,
and five daughters, Mrs. Florence Cherry of Conroe, Mrs. Maggie Lovett
of Alaska, Mrs. Blanch Thomas of Marston, Mrs. Mabel Bean of Houston, and
Miss Nella Jewel Hughes of Livingston.
